German wheat beers, with their citrusy flavors and effervescence, are especially good with fried fish tacos, cutting through the overall richness with ease, but at the same time the slightly creamy mouthfeel resonates perfectly with toppings like crema and guacamole. —jesse vallins (the saint tavern) Plus, a hint of spicy oak can pair nicely with the char.
